Natural resources law governs the management and use of natural assets such as land, water, minerals, and wildlife.
It ensures that resource use complies with environmental protection and property rights laws applicable in Missouri.

Natural resources owned or controlled are often part of an estate and require specific planning to ensure proper management and transfer.
Incorporating resource considerations in estate plans safeguards property value and complies with Missouri regulations.
